I would call 2 independent agents and let them find the best deal with no named storm deductible that is a percentage of your house.

These insurance companies are getting wise to the hail storm craze that has supported all these roofing companies in BR. So many of these guys in roofing companies give kick backs to the adjusters and the scratch each other’s back. Have you tried fighting that with a lawyer or public adjuster? A shingle roof is a system and if you break the system, problems technically can arise. State Farm knows this. They’re fricking you because you haven’t fought it hard enough. Don’t give up, win, then leave.
